Hotel Description

Look, I’ll be honest – when I first walked up to Appartement Oslo on Rue d’Oslo, I wasn’t expecting much from the street view. It’s this quiet residential road that most tourists completely miss, tucked away from the main Strasbourg bustle. But you know what? That turned out to be exactly why this place works so well.

The building itself has that understated French charm – none of the flashy hotel lobby nonsense, just clean lines and this surprisingly welcoming entrance that makes you feel like you’re staying at a friend’s well-appointed apartment rather than some cookie-cutter chain. And honestly, that 9.1 rating makes perfect sense once you’re inside. The rooms are thoughtfully laid out (I mean, someone actually considered where you’d want to plug in your phone), and there’s this attention to small details that you don’t usually get at three-star places. The morning light comes in beautifully if you snag one of the street-facing units, and the neighborhood is genuinely quiet – no drunk tourists stumbling around at 2 AM like you get closer to the cathedral area.

What really sold me on this spot is the location itself. Rue d’Oslo sits in this sweet spot where you’re close enough to walk to Petite France in about fifteen minutes (and it’s actually a lovely walk through some residential streets that feel properly French), but you’re not paying those tourist-zone prices or dealing with crowds outside your door. There’s a decent boulangerie about two blocks down that the locals actually use – always a good sign – and you can catch the tram pretty easily if you want to venture further out. The Parc de l’Orangerie is practically around the corner, which I didn’t realize until my second day there, and it’s perfect for morning runs or just escaping the city feel for a bit. Parking can be a bit tricky on the street (like anywhere in Strasbourg), but the staff actually knows the neighborhood well enough to give you real advice about where to find spots, not just vague directions. They’re the kind of helpful that feels genuine rather than scripted, if that makes sense. I’d definitely come back here – it’s one of those places that gets the balance right between being comfortable and actually feeling like you’re experiencing the city rather than hiding from it in some sterile hotel bubble.

Reviews

  • Very nice apartment, walking distance to the city center – Sergio from Germany – 23 July 2025 (10/10)

    Very nice and well equipped apartment. A lot of space for two persons, looks exactly as in the photos. Easy checkin and checkout, it's a nice walk to the city center. Free parking on the street, or in an internal courtyard. Quiet area close to the university.

  • Pleasant stay in a great location – Eva from United Kingdom – 15 July 2025 (9/10)

    Great location, detailed and clear check-in instructions, friendly and helpful host when we run into issues when exiting the car park, it had a washing machine.

    What could be improved: The mattress was too soft, but that’s based on personal preference. The shower drain was a bit blocked.

  • Really nice – Janina from Germany – 22 June 2025 (8/10)

    Very spacious and clean. Beautifully decorated.

    What could be improved: It got really hot inside the apartment. There was a portable fan that didn’t do much for the temperature though. The curtains were see-through and didn’t keep it dark during the early morning; some people don’t mind but I woke up with the first ray of sunlight.

  • Take it ! – Elizaveta from France – 29 April 2025 (10/10)

    Perfect appartement ! Clean, with a lot of light, nice deco. But I agree with comments indicatating that it’s comfortable for 2 persons max.

    What could be improved: The information about the appartment location can be improved. The appartement is in a house with many entrances, so each entrance is actually a house number. That was confusing

  • Exceptional – Michael from United Kingdom – 22 April 2025 (10/10)

    Very well presented and comfortable in a quiet area 15 minutes tram ride from the city.

  • Very good – Paolo from Italy – 31 December 2024 (8/10)

    The apartment has all you need for a short as well long stay and it is located in a quiet area.

    What could be improved: The owner gave us the check-in instruction just the same day of arrival.

  • Superb – Ron from Italy – 26 October 2024 (9/10)

    Please be careful with phone and try to reply quicker.

    What could be improved: Everything was great. Thank you

  • Exceptional – Piotr from Poland – 21 October 2024 (10/10)

    Spacious, clean, and well-equipped apartment with all the modern amenities and fully functional kitchen. Convenient location in a quiet part of Strassburg, but within a walking distance to the university campus and the city centre. Secure parking, accessible with an automatic gate opener, next to the building. Reliable wifi.

    What could be improved: The communication with the owner was OK, but the info on the check-in could have been sent slightly earlier rather in the final hours before the arrival.

  • Exceptional – Viorica from Romania – 3 October 2024 (10/10)

    Beautiful, clean apartment, with parking available, close to tram station.

  • Very good – Leonid from Greece – 18 July 2024 (8/10)

    Nice and quiet place to stay!

    What could be improved: Windows needed cleaning :)) but everything else was good!
